Safety

strictly-beds-bunks-avalon-midi-sleeper-cabin-bed-3ft-single-5652.jpgBunk beds are a great solution for children, provided they are properly supervised. It is important to set up rules to ensure that your children are secure in their bunk beds. These rules could include avoiding hanging things from the bunk beds (such as belts, scarves or jump ropes) because they are strangulation hazards and ensuring that kids use the bed as a place for sleep. Bunk beds are also hazardous, so children should use the ladder with caution.

When purchasing bunk beds, look for one that has been inspected by an independent laboratory and meets or surpasses US safety standards. Make sure the guard rails on the top bunk are tall enough to stop children from falling off the mattress, and that there are no gaps or gaps that children's heads or limbs might be stuck in. It's a good idea purchase a bunk bed that has integrated or built-in shelving on the top bunk so that your kids have a place to store things they'll require at night, such as drinks, books and clocks. There are also clip-on lights that attach easily to the rails of guards on the top of the bunk so that your kids can access the light at night without having to climb out of their beds.

Even older children can sleep safely on the top bunk. But it's crucial to remind them to be vigilant when climbing the ladder and not to play in or around the bed. If your kids are sleeping on the top bunk, you must teach them to remove any hazardous objects from the bed. Also, keep the bunks far away from ceiling fans.

Space Saving

Bunk beds take the vertical space of a room to the maximum, providing more floor area for kids to play or study. They're also an excellent choice for shared rooms, allowing siblings to sleep together in comfort without compromising their privacy or the overall style of the room.

Selecting a bunk bed that's right for your kids may require some compromise. If your kids aren't quite ready to climb to the top bunk, you might want to consider a low or loft design that has one mattress on the ground and another above. This design makes it simpler for younger children to get in and out of the bed. However, older children can still take pleasure in the excitement of sleeping higher up.

When you are deciding on a bunk bed for your kids, make sure the ladder or stairs are safe and sturdy. You don't want a ladder that is too narrow or wobbly to your kids, as they can be rough with furniture. Look for a ladder that has guardrails on the sides as well as an angled ladder to ensure safety. Also, look for an elevated step-up that is low to the ground so that even children of all ages can climb it.

If you have two kids who fight over the top bunk, select the layout that only one child can sleep there. This will help avoid a fight. You can also choose the corner bunk, which is a combination of two beds that are elevated in a corner of the bedroom to ensure everyone is happy while allowing more space for play or study.

Style

Bunk beds are a great option for children sharing a room. A traditional bunk bed will feature two twin-sized mattresses, placed one on top of the other. This is a great option for siblings who need to sleep together, but have their own beds. Many bunk bed uk beds will also offer the option of a trundle bed that can be tucked under the bottom twin mattress. This lets three people rest comfortably on a bunk bed, which is ideal for children who have guests over for sleepovers.

Most bunk beds are made of solid wood, which is strong and durable. This ensures a safe and long-lasting frame. Certain bunk beds will be coated in white that is modern and fresh in any bedroom. Others could be made with classic colors like natural wood stain. The right finish allows you to make bunks that match the rooms of your children with other furniture and accessories as well as the decor. This will create a cohesive look for their room that will last for a long time.

Another crucial aspect of a bunk bed is the safety features that will be included. Be sure that the bunk bed you purchase comes with side rails on the top of the bed to stop your children from falling out of bed at night. You should also find out if the bed has passed safety tests conducted by a reliable third party lab to make sure it will be a good choice for your family.

You may also want to consider a ladder that has built-in storage. This is a great way to save space. A lot of bunk beds have the option for a staircase instead of a ladder, which is more convenient for kids to use when they are young. The stairs can be tucked away when not in use. Some even have drawers built into the steps to give you additional storage.
